Senior Staff Engineer - CRM

GEICO
Indianapolis, IN
$120K-$300.5K a year
Full-time

Position Summary

GEICO is seeking an experienced Engineer with a passion for building high-performance, low maintenance, zero-downtime platforms, and applications.

You will help drive our insurance business transformation as we transition from a traditional IT model to a tech organization with engineering excellence as its mission, while co-creating the culture of psychological safety and continuous improvement.

Position Description

Our Sr. Staff Engineer works with Staff and Sr. Engineers to innovate and build new systems, improve, and enhance existing systems and identify new opportunities to apply their knowledge to solve critical problems.

You will lead the strategy and execution of a technical roadmap that will increase the velocity of delivering products and unlock new engineering capabilities.

The ideal candidate has deep technical expertise in their domain.

Position Responsibilities

As a Sr. Staff Engineer, you will :

  • Focus on multiple areas and provide technical leadership to the enterprise
  • Collaborate with product managers, team members, customers, and other engineering teams to solve complex problems
  • Develop and execute technical software development strategy for a variety of domains
  • Accountable for the quality, usability, and performance of the solutions
  • Utilize programming languages like Python, C# or other object-oriented languages, SQL, and NoSQL databases, Container Orchestration services including Docker and Kubernetes, and a variety of Azure tools and services
  • Mentor and help coach and strengthen the technical expertise and know-how of our engineering and product community
  • Influence and educate leadership at all levels
  • Consistently share best practices and improve processes within and across teams
  • Analyze cost and forecast, incorporating them into business plans
  • Determine and support resource requirements, evaluate operational processes, measure outcomes to ensure desired results, demonstrate adaptability and sponsor continuous learning

Qualifications

  • Fluency and specialization with at least two modern languages such as Java, C++, Python or C# including object-oriented design
  • Experience building products of micro-services oriented architecture and extensible REST APIs
  • Experience building the architecture and design of new and current systems (architecture, design patterns, reliability, and scaling)
  • Experience with continuous delivery and infrastructure as code
  • Fluency in DevOps Concepts, Cloud Architecture and Azure DevOps Operational Framework
  • Experience in leveraging PowerShell scripting
  • Experience in existing operational portals such as Azure Portal
  • Experience with application monitoring tools and performance assessments
  • Experience in Datacenter structure, capabilities, and offerings, including the Azure platform and its native services
  • Experience in security protocols and products : understanding of Active Directory, Windows Authentication, SAML, OAuth
  • Experience in Azure Network (subscription, security zoning, etc.)
  • In-depth knowledge of CS data structures and algorithms
  • Experience with solving analytical problems with quantitative approaches
  • Ability to excel in a fast-paced, startup-like environment
  • Knowledge of developer tooling across the software development life cycle (task management, source code, building, deployment, operations, real-time communication)
  • Exemplary ability to design, perform experiments, and influence engineering direction and product roadmap
  • Experience partnering with engineering teams and transferring research to production
  • Track-record of publications history in credible conferences and journals
  • Experience with Salesforce service cloud development environment including but not limited to items such as custom objects, declarative functionality, workflows, triggers, Visual Force, migration tools, and SOQL

Experience

  • 12+ years of professional software development experience on an enterprise Salesforce platform (Financial Services Cloud, Marketing Cloud, Sales Cloud, or Service Cloud)
  • 10+ years of experience with architecture and design
  • 6+ years of experience with AWS, GCP, Azure, or another cloud service
  • 6+ years of experience in open-source frameworks

Education

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or equivalent education or work experience

Annual Salary

$120,000.00 - $300,500.00

The above annual salary range is a general guideline. Multiple factors are taken into consideration to arrive at the final hourly rate / annual salary to be offered to the selected candidate.

Factors include, but are not limited to, the scope and responsibilities of the role, the selected candidate’s work experience, education and training, the work location as well as market and business considerations.
